How long do RVs hold their value?

|

RV Shepherd is a well-established and trusted RV Inspection company. Let’s dive into the topic and explore the factors that play a significant role in determining how long RVs retain their value.

1. Introduction to RV Value Retention

When considering the value of an RV, several factors come into play. The first step in understanding how long an RV holds its value is recognizing the different types of recreational vehicles available. Class A motorhomes, Class B vans, Class C motorhomes, travel trailers, fifth wheels, and camper vans are among the popular options in the market today.

2. Quality and Durability of RVs

When investing in a recreational vehicle, one of the key considerations should be the quality and durability of the RV. Higher-quality RVs, constructed with superior materials and craftsmanship, tend to hold their value for a longer period. 3. Maintenance and Care

Proper maintenance and care play a crucial role in determining the longevity of an RV’s value. Regular servicing, cleaning, and addressing any mechanical or cosmetic issues promptly can help maintain the value of the RV. 6. Brand Reputation

The reputation of the RV manufacturer can also impact how long an RV retains its value. Well-established brands with a history of producing reliable and high-quality vehicles tend to hold their value better over time.
